How to Use Our AI Prompts to Make Everyday Life a Little Easier

AI can be impressive, but for most people, the real value is not in doing flashy things. It is in making normal life easier.

 

That is where everyday AI prompts come in.

 

Instead of staring at a blank screen and wondering what to ask, a good prompt gives you a starting point. It helps you explain your situation clearly so the AI can give you something useful back.

 

Our everyday prompts are built for real life. They are meant to help when your schedule is messy, dinner is undecided, your house feels out of control, your to-do list is growing, or you just need help thinking through the next step.

 

The good news is this: you do not need to be techy to use them well.

 

Start with one real problem.

 

The best way to use an AI prompt is to give it a real situation, not a vague idea.

 

For example, instead of saying, “Help me get organized,” say, “My kitchen is a mess, I have two kids at home, I am behind on laundry, and I need a simple plan for the next two hours.”

 

That kind of detail helps the AI give you a better answer.

 

Use the prompt as a starting point, not a magic trick.

 

A prompt is not there to do your whole life for you. It is there to help you think more clearly, move faster, and stop getting stuck at the beginning.

 

If the first answer is not quite right, keep going.

 

You can say things like:

 

  • Make this simpler.
  • Give me a version that costs less.
  • Use what I already have at home.
  • Make this work for a busy mom.
  • Turn this into a step-by-step checklist.
  • Explain it like I am overwhelmed and need the easiest version first.

 

That is how you get better results. You refine the answer until it actually fits your life.

 

Some of the best everyday uses are surprisingly simple.

 

You can use AI prompts to build a meal plan based on what is already in your kitchen. You can use them to create a simple cleaning reset plan for your home. You can use them to organize errands, map out a busy week, come up with homeschool ideas, write a better text message, or break a stressful situation into smaller steps.

 

Sometimes the biggest win is not saving hours. Sometimes it is saving your mental energy.

 

Here is a good example of an everyday prompt:

 

Act like a practical everyday helper. I’m dealing with [problem]. Ask me the 3 most important questions first, then give me a simple step-by-step plan using what I already have. Keep it realistic, calm, and easy to follow.

 

This works because it tells the AI what role to play, what kind of response you want, and what kind of tone helps most.

 

It also reminds the AI not to overcomplicate things.

 

The more honest you are, the more useful the result usually is.

 

If you are tired, say that. If money is tight, say that. If you only have 20 minutes, say that. If you hate complicated plans, say that too.

 

AI works better when you give it real limits.

 

That is what helps turn a generic answer into something you can actually use.

 

Think of AI as a helper, not a replacement for your judgment.

 

AI can help you think, plan, organize, simplify, and brainstorm. What it should not do is replace wisdom, common sense, or personal responsibility.

 

Use it to save time. Use it to reduce stress. Use it to make decisions easier to sort through. But always filter the answer through your real life, your priorities, and what you know is best for your home or family.
